Signature spoofing, which is a feature required by microg, failed to function in the latest crdroid build(20231223), and microg complained that this permission cannot be granted. It used to work in previous beta build though.
Steps to reproduce
Use ota to upgrade from previous beta version, or flash it in recovery.
Relevant log (logcat/build log)
12-24 01:55:34.916 3404 3404 E GrantPermissionsViewModel: None of [android.permission.FAKE_PACKAGE_SIGNATURE] in {android.permission-group.NOTIFICATIONS=[android.permission.POST_NOTIFICATIONS]}
12-24 01:55:36.926 3404 3404 E GrantPermissionsViewModel: None of [android.permission.FAKE_PACKAGE_SIGNATURE] in {android.permission-group.LOCATION=[android.permission.ACCESS_COARSE_LOCATION, android.permission.ACCESS_FINE_LOCATION, android.permission.ACCESS_BACKGROUND_LOCATION], android.permission-group.PHONE=[android.permission.READ_PHONE_STATE], android.permission-group.CONTACTS=[android.permission.GET_ACCOUNTS, android.permission.READ_CONTACTS], android.permission-group.STORAGE=[android.permission.WRITE_EXTERNAL_STORAGE, android.permission.READ_EXTERNAL_STORAGE], android.permission-group.SENSORS=[android.permission.BODY_SENSORS, android.permission.BODY_SENSORS_BACKGROUND], android.permission-group.SMS=[android.permission.RECEIVE_SMS], android.permission-group.NEARBY_DEVICES=[android.permission.BLUETOOTH_ADVERTISE, android.permission.BLUETOOTH_CONNECT, android.permission.BLUETOOTH_SCAN], android.permission-group.NOTIFICATIONS=[android.permission.POST_NOTIFICATIONS], android.permission-group.READ_MEDIA_AURAL=[android.permission.READ_MEDIA_AUDIO], android.permission-group.READ_MEDIA_VISUAL=[android.permission.READ_MEDIA_VIDEO, android.permission.READ_MEDIA_IMAGES, android.permission.READ_MEDIA_VISUAL_USER_SELECTED]}
Screenshots or videos
Solution
No response
Additional context
No response
Acknowledgements
[X] I've checked device is officially supported (for device specific reports and not source related).
[X] I'm running latest version available on crdroid.net for this device
[X] I have searched the existing issues and this is a new and no duplicate or related to another open issue.
[X] I have written a short but informative title.
[X] I filled out all of the requested information in this issue properly.
Issue type
Feature not working as intended
Device
oneplus 11 (salami)
crDroid version
crDroid 10
Exact version / Build date
10.0/2023-12-23
Bug description
Signature spoofing, which is a feature required by microg, failed to function in the latest crdroid build(20231223), and microg complained that this permission cannot be granted. It used to work in previous beta build though.
Steps to reproduce
Use ota to upgrade from previous beta version, or flash it in recovery.
Relevant log (logcat/build log)
Screenshots or videos
Solution
No response
Additional context
No response
Acknowledgements